What Is Progressive Care?

Progressive Care bridges the gap between intensive care and general medical care. It allows us to care for patients with more complex needs — right here in Wagoner. From cardiac and non-cardiac drips to continuous monitoring, our team is equipped to provide a higher level of support without requiring transfer to larger facilities.

24/7 Emergency Services

The Wagoner Community Hospital Emergency Department is open 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, and with an emergency physician and expert support staff always on duty, we are equipped to handle a wide variety of emergent situations quickly and efficiently.

In addition to serving as a receiving station for ambulance and emergency services throughout Wagoner County and surrounding areas, the Emergency Department also has access to all major critical care helicopter transport services.

Our hospital is also classified as an ASRH (Acute Stroke-Ready Hospital), meaning that when seconds count — especially during the “Golden Hour” during or after a trauma such as a stroke — we’re here, equipped and ready to guide patients with rapid diagnosis and quick onset of treatment.
